The Supreme Court rejects Salianji's request, DP reacts: Political re-sentence under Rama's orders

The Supreme Court rejects Salianji's request, DP reacts: Political

The Democratic Party has considered as a re-sentence of the democratic deputy Ervin Salianji the decision of the Supreme Court taken today by rejecting his request for the suspension of the sentence. 

The Secretary for Legal Affairs in the Democratic Party, Ivi Kaso, said in a statement to the media that the detention of the vice president of the Democratic parliamentary group is a medal for him and the opposition, and a stain of shame for the government and its courts, which according to him have turned the persecution of opposition figures into a witch hunt.

Full statement:

The Democratic Party considers the Supreme Court's decision taken today under the pressure and orders of Edi Rama as a re-sentence of the Democratic MP Ervin Salianji.
Against an illegal and politically motivated decision, the body of the Supreme Court neither rose to the task nor served the balance between the powers in Albania which Edi Rama has erased with a stroke of the pencil.
The detention of the deputy chairman of the democratic parliamentary group is a medal for him and the opposition, and a stain of shame on the government and its courts, which have turned the persecution of opposition exponents into a witch hunt.
The Democratic Party once again expresses its support for its deputy and for every opposition voice that stands up against the regime.
The DP emphasizes that there is no peace without the release of all the opponents unjustly kept in solitary confinement or in cells.
The servants of Edi Rama and Fatmir Xhafajt in the judiciary cannot silence the opposition nor force it to, like them, turn into a complaint against the government.
